The Antarctic Treaty System, established in 1961, represents a landmark agreement in international relations, focusing on the governance of Antarctica. This treaty was born out of a collective desire to ensure that the continent would be used exclusively for peaceful purposes and scientific research. The original signatories, twelve nations, recognized the unique status of Antarctica and sought to prevent territorial disputes that could arise from competing national interests.

The treaty has since expanded to include over fifty parties, reflecting a broad consensus on the need for cooperative stewardship of this fragile environment. At its core, the Antarctic Treaty System emphasizes the importance of collaboration among nations. It prohibits military activity, nuclear testing, and mineral mining, thereby establishing Antarctica as a zone of peace and science.

The treaty also promotes the free exchange of scientific information and encourages international cooperation in research endeavors. This framework has allowed scientists from various countries to work together, sharing knowledge and resources to better understand the continent’s complex ecosystems and climate dynamics. The treaty’s success lies in its ability to adapt to changing circumstances while maintaining its foundational principles.

International Cooperation and Governance

International cooperation in Antarctica is not merely a theoretical concept; it is a practical necessity given the continent’s unique challenges. The governance structure established by the Antarctic Treaty System facilitates collaboration among nations, allowing them to address issues that transcend national borders. This cooperative spirit is evident in the annual Antarctic Treaty Consultative Meetings, where representatives from member countries convene to discuss scientific research, environmental protection, and logistical support for expeditions.

These meetings serve as a platform for dialogue and consensus-building, fostering a sense of shared responsibility for the stewardship of Antarctica.

Moreover, the governance framework extends beyond the treaty itself. Various organizations and initiatives have emerged to support international cooperation in Antarctic affairs.

For instance, the Scientific Committee on Antarctic Research (SCAR) plays a crucial role in coordinating scientific efforts and promoting interdisciplinary research. By facilitating collaboration among scientists from different countries, SCAR enhances the collective understanding of Antarctica’s ecosystems and climate change impacts. This collaborative approach not only strengthens scientific inquiry but also reinforces the notion that global challenges require unified responses.

Environmental protection in Antarctica is paramount, given the continent’s delicate ecosystems and unique biodiversity. The Antarctic Treaty System includes provisions aimed at safeguarding the environment, emphasizing the need for responsible conduct in scientific research and exploration. The Protocol on Environmental Protection to the Antarctic Treaty, adopted in 1991, further strengthens these commitments by designating Antarctica as a “natural reserve devoted to peace and science.” This protocol outlines specific measures to minimize human impact on the environment, including guidelines for waste management and wildlife conservation.

The commitment to environmental protection extends beyond regulatory frameworks; it is also reflected in the actions of individual nations and organizations operating in Antarctica. Many countries have established their own environmental policies that align with international standards, ensuring that their activities do not compromise the integrity of the ecosystem. Additionally, collaborative initiatives such as the Antarctic Conservation Strategy promote awareness and education about the importance of preserving this unique environment for future generations.

Resource Management and Regulation

Resource management in Antarctica presents a complex challenge due to the continent’s vast natural resources and the potential for exploitation. While the Antarctic Treaty prohibits mineral mining, there are ongoing discussions about how to manage other resources, such as fisheries and marine life. The Convention on the Conservation of Antarctic Marine Living Resources (CCAMLR) was established to regulate fishing activities in the Southern Ocean, ensuring that these resources are harvested sustainably.

This agreement reflects a commitment to balancing economic interests with ecological preservation. The management of resources in Antarctica requires ongoing vigilance and cooperation among nations. As global demand for seafood increases, illegal fishing poses a significant threat to marine ecosystems in the region.

To combat this issue, member countries must work together to enforce regulations and monitor fishing activities effectively. Collaborative efforts are essential not only for protecting marine biodiversity but also for ensuring that future generations can benefit from these resources without compromising the health of the ecosystem.

Tourism and Commercial Activities

Tourism in Antarctica has grown significantly over recent years, driven by an increasing interest in adventure travel and unique experiences. While tourism can provide economic benefits and raise awareness about environmental issues, it also poses challenges for conservation efforts. The influx of visitors can lead to disturbances in wildlife habitats and increased waste generation, necessitating careful management to minimize impacts on the fragile ecosystem.

To address these challenges, regulations governing tourism activities have been established through the Antarctic Treaty System. These guidelines aim to ensure that tourism is conducted responsibly and sustainably while preserving the integrity of the environment. Tour operators are required to adhere to strict protocols regarding wildlife interactions, waste disposal, and environmental education for travelers.

By promoting responsible tourism practices, stakeholders can help foster a greater appreciation for Antarctica’s natural beauty while safeguarding its ecological health.

FAQs

Who is responsible for managing the Antarctic grid?

The Antarctic grid, which refers to the network of scientific stations, communication systems, and logistical infrastructure, is managed collectively by the countries that operate research stations in Antarctica. There is no single entity controlling the entire grid; instead, coordination occurs under the framework of the Antarctic Treaty System.

What is the Antarctic Treaty System?

The Antarctic Treaty System is an international agreement signed in 1959 that regulates international relations with respect to Antarctica. It promotes scientific cooperation, bans military activity, and ensures that Antarctica is used for peaceful purposes. The treaty facilitates collaboration among countries operating in Antarctica, including the management of shared resources and infrastructure.

How do countries coordinate their activities in Antarctica?

Countries coordinate their activities through consultative meetings under the Antarctic Treaty System. These meetings allow member nations to share information, plan logistics, and manage environmental protection efforts. Coordination helps avoid conflicts and ensures efficient use of resources, including the Antarctic grid infrastructure.

Are there any organizations that oversee Antarctic communications?

While no single organization controls all Antarctic communications, various national Antarctic programs manage their own communication networks. Additionally, international cooperation exists to ensure compatibility and reliability of communication systems, including satellite links and radio frequencies used for scientific and operational purposes.

Is the Antarctic grid used for civilian purposes?

Yes, the Antarctic grid primarily supports scientific research and environmental monitoring. It includes power grids at research stations, communication networks, and transportation logistics. The infrastructure is designed to support the unique needs of the scientific community operating in the harsh Antarctic environment.

Can private companies control or operate parts of the Antarctic grid?

Private companies may provide services or equipment to support Antarctic operations, but control and management of the grid infrastructure remain under the jurisdiction of national Antarctic programs and treaty parties. The Antarctic Treaty restricts commercial exploitation and emphasizes scientific collaboration.

How is environmental protection ensured in managing the Antarctic grid?

Environmental protection is a key principle of the Antarctic Treaty System. All activities, including the operation of the Antarctic grid, must comply with strict environmental protocols. This includes minimizing pollution, managing waste, and protecting native wildlife and ecosystems during the construction and operation of infrastructure.
